Output fa6c28d7772b7ea8107a832a2cfc8ab1955890a01310d047415aad5dfcbcc94a:5

value
35488077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d54ac361a1009c12da87652d347fcf3a24c173 OP_EQUAL
address
384G4a5JwU8CJa2R15hKTBAfFEaRT4EMRa
transaction
fa6c28d7772b7ea8107a832a2cfc8ab1955890a01310d047415aad5dfcbcc94a
spent
true